IoT: A Powerful Tool for Wildlife Conservation

IoT involves the use of sensors, cameras, and other devices to collect data on wildlife behavior, habitat health, and other critical parameters. This data is then transmitted to a central hub, where it’s analyzed to inform conservation decisions. The benefits of IoT for wildlife conservation are multifaceted:

* Enhanced monitoring: IoT devices can be deployed in remote or hard-to-reach areas, providing real-time data on wildlife populations and habitats.

* Improved conservation planning: By analyzing IoT data, conservationists can identify areas of high conservation value and develop targeted strategies to protect them.

* Increased efficiency: IoT automation can streamline conservation efforts, reducing costs and enhancing the effectiveness of conservation programs.

Real-World Applications of IoT in Wildlife Conservation

1. Camera traps: IoT-enabled camera traps can be used to monitor wildlife populations, track movement patterns, and detect poaching activity.

2. Acoustic sensors: Acoustic sensors can be used to detect and analyze animal vocalizations, providing insights into population dynamics and habitat health.

3. Satellite tracking: IoT-enabled satellite tracking devices can be used to monitor animal migration patterns, habitat use, and behavior.

Case Study: Using IoT to Protect Endangered Elephants

The Wildlife Conservation Society (WCS) has been working with the Indian government to protect endangered elephants using IoT technology. The project involves the deployment of IoT-enabled camera traps and acoustic sensors in elephant habitats, which provide real-time data on elephant populations and habitat health.
